Shielding Your WordPress Platform From Malware
In the ever-evolving landscape of online threats, securing your WordPress site from malware is paramount. WordPress's extensive user base makes it a prime target for malicious website actors seeking to exploit vulnerabilities and compromise websites. To ensure your site remains safe and operational, it's essential to implement robust security measures. Regularly patch your WordPress core, themes, and plugins to the latest versions, as these updates often include critical security fixes. Choose strong, unique passwords for your WordPress admin account and other sensitive areas. Consider a reputable security plugin to enhance protection by scanning for malware, detecting suspicious activity, and implementing firewall rules.
- Enforce two-factor authentication (copyright) to add an extra layer of security to your login process.
- Back up your website regularly to ensure you have a recent snapshot in case of a malware attack.
- Scrutinize your site's logs for any unusual activity that could indicate a breach.
By adhering to these best practices, you can significantly minimize the risk of malware infections and keep your WordPress site secure.
Tackle WordPress Malware Quickly
Discovering malware on your WordPress site can be a nightmare. Harmful code lurking in your files can threaten everything from your site's performance to your visitors' security. But don't panic! Restoring your site from malware is achievable with the right approach. First, identify the issue. Leverage reputable security plugins or tools to scan for threats and pinpoint the source of the malware. Once identified, isolate the infected files. This may involve accessing your site's core files through an FTP client or using a dedicated WordPress file manager. After removal, install strong security measures to prevent future attacks. Regularly back up your site, strengthen your passwords, and stay informed about the latest security threats.
